Kakoulidis Vineyards is a family business in Pieria, Greece, an area on the slopes of the mythical mount Olympos with a rich wine-growing tradition and excellent wine characteristics.

The logo and the brochures introduce the company to the public in an elegant and straightforward manner. The aim was to emphasize the importance that the company gives to quality and detail.

In the two editions (English and Greek) special printing and bookbinding techniques were applied, such as foil printing and special saddle-stitching, adding value to the brand and creating a memorable experience for the audience.

I decided to use Publico for the headlines because of its classic beauty and grace, creating notions of validity and premiumness, qualities that are suitable to the topic of quality wine-making. On the other hand, for the body copy, I chose Commissioner, a work-horse font suitable for extensive text, for its legibility and its clear contrast to Publico.
